Abstract :
Based on the reliability index of a new-type towed anti-aircraft gun system, the inherent reliability level of the gun system is calculated. The effect of the system reliability parameters on the system´s performance is assessed, and the application of design principle of system-reliability-centered maintainability and supportability to complex systems is analyzed.
